Stupidly, I am listening to Buddy Songy on the radio. I know that is my first mistake. He is a Miles basher and blames all of the offensive problems on the fact that he believes Miles is running the offense and running the ball up the middle on every first and second down. Of course, he just cut off a guy who was asking questions and blaming Crowton.

My question is this, I do not remember seeing LSU run the ball up the middle every first and second down. In fact, I was hoping they would actually line up in the I-form and run the ball on occasion on first and second down. What I have seen is scatter-brained playcalling out of different random formations. There isn't any flow or consistency. I haven't seen what I would classify as a Les Miles offense. Is everyone else seeing something different?

When I went back and watched the Florida game, I was surprised to find that our most effective runs (rare as they may have been) were up the middle between the tackles. We were awful at running the option and running outside.

There was one glaring exception to this general trend, which probably explains the perception of the general public.

On third and goal from the two, we ran up the middle and got stuffed. Fans will recall that.
